Gourmet Wrap Mastery Secrets for Perfect Grilled Shrimp Caesar Combination
Shrimp Size: Use large or jumbo shrimp for best texture and visual appeal in wraps.
Grilling Technique: Don't overcook shrimp - they should be pink and slightly charred but tender.
Lettuce Prep: Pat romaine completely dry to prevent soggy wraps from excess moisture.
Wrap Assembly: Don't overfill wraps - this makes them difficult to roll and eat.
Temperature Control: Serve wraps while shrimp is still warm for optimal flavor and texture.
Dressing Balance: Make dressing slightly thicker than traditional to prevent dripping from wraps.

Ingredients

Custard Cream
01
For the Perfect Grilled Shrimp:
02
1.5 pounds large shrimp, peeled and deveined
03
3 tablespoons olive oil
04
2 teaspoons garlic powder
05
1 teaspoon paprika
06
1/2 teaspoon salt
07
1/4 teaspoon black pepper
08
For the Caesar Dressing:
09
1/2 cup mayonnaise
10
1/4 cup grated Parmesan cheese
11
2 tablespoons lemon juice
12
2 cloves garlic, minced
13
1 teaspoon Worcestershire sauce
14
1 teaspoon Dijon mustard
15
1/2 teaspoon anchovy paste
16
For the Wrap Foundation:
17
4 large flour tortillas
18
2 tablespoons butter, softened
19
For the Fresh Components:
20
1 large head romaine lettuce, chopped
21
1/2 cup shaved Parmesan cheese
22
1/4 cup red onion, thinly sliced
23
1 avocado, sliced
24
For the Flavor Enhancers:
25
2 tablespoons fresh lemon juice
26
1 tablespoon fresh parsley, chopped
27
1/2 teaspoon garlic powder
28
For the Crouton Alternative:
29
1 cup seasoned croutons, crushed
30
2 tablespoons olive oil
31
For the Gourmet Touches:
32
2 tablespoons fresh chives, chopped
33
Coarse sea salt
34
Freshly cracked black pepper
35
For the Perfect Assembly:
36
Toothpicks for securing
37
Parchment paper for wrapping
38
For Special Equipment:
39
Grill pan or outdoor grill
40
Mixing bowls
41
Tongs
42
Sharp knife

Instructions

01
Preheat grill pan or outdoor grill to medium-high heat.
02
Pat shrimp dry and toss with olive oil, garlic powder, paprika, salt, and pepper.
03
Let seasoned shrimp marinate for 10 minutes at room temperature.
04
Meanwhile, prepare Caesar dressing by whisking together all dressing ingredients.
05
Taste dressing and adjust seasoning with salt, pepper, and lemon juice.
06
Chop romaine lettuce into bite-sized pieces and place in large bowl.
07
Slice red onion thinly and prepare avocado slices just before assembly.
08
Grill shrimp for 2-3 minutes per side until pink and slightly charred.
09
Remove shrimp from grill and let cool slightly before handling.
10
Warm tortillas in dry skillet or microwave until pliable.
11
Toss chopped romaine with half the Caesar dressing until well coated.
12
Add crushed croutons to dressed lettuce for extra crunch.
13
Lay each tortilla flat and spread remaining dressing in center.
14
Divide dressed romaine lettuce evenly among the four tortillas.
15
Top each with 6-8 grilled shrimp arranged in single layer.
16
Add shaved Parmesan cheese generously over the shrimp.
17
Layer with red onion slices and avocado for extra flavor.
18
Sprinkle with fresh chives and additional black pepper.
19
Fold bottom edge of tortilla over filling, then fold sides in.
20
Roll tightly from bottom to top, ensuring filling stays contained.
21
Secure each wrap with toothpicks and cut diagonally in half.
22
Wrap individual portions in parchment paper for easy handling.
23
Serve immediately while shrimp is still warm and lettuce crisp.
24
Accompany with extra Caesar dressing and lemon wedges for serving.
